Global EV sales are ‘robust’ – more than 1 in 5 cars sold in 2024 will be electric

Baua Electric

More than 1 in 5 cars sold globally this year is expected to be electric, with surging demand projected over the next decade, says a new International Energy Agency (IEA) report. The latest IEA Outlook report asserts that global EV sales are set to remain “robust” in 2024, reaching around 17 million by the end of the year.

Volvo Cars reports sales of 58,667 cars worldwide in March, down 22.1%; electrified share increased to 36%

Green Car Congress

During the first quarter, the number of cars sold increased gradually to a total of 148,295 cars as the supply chain constraints affecting Volvo Cars and the auto industry continued to slowly ease. In March, sales of Volvo Cars’ Recharge models made up 35.5% of all Volvo cars sold globally during the month.
